8.8 Colliders

A variable is a collider on a particular path if, on that path, both arrows point at it.

  • A path is closed by default if a collider sits on it
  • The path opens up if the collider is controlled for

Because once you control for the collider, the two variables pointing to the collider become related.

We can avoid colliders by

  • not controlling for them
  • not choosing a sample where the collider is automatically controlled for
